Shares of Nexj Programs Inc. jumped in early buying and selling Monday after the corporate stated it will be purchased at a premium to its latest share value.
At 9:32 a.m., the shares have been 40% increased at C$0.53.
The Canadian cloud-based software program supplier stated that N. Harris Pc Corp., a subsidiary of Constellation Software program Inc., will purchase the entire firm’s excellent frequent shares for 55 Canadian cents apiece, the equal of 42 U.S. cents.
The worth per share is a premium to Friday’s share closing value of C$0.38, and a 35% premium to the volume-weighted common value of its shares during the last 20 buying and selling days, it stated.
